There are 15 child daycare & preschools in Tonawanda, New York, making up 94% of the 16 total childcare facilities in the city. Below you'll find a complete directory to help you compare and choose the right daycare for your child.
Based on Google reviews, daycares in Tonawanda have an average rating of 4.49 out of 5 across 11 rated facilities, with 64% scoring 4.5 stars or higher. Headstart Programs facilities lead with an average of 4.6 stars. Our analysis covers 80 parent reviews.
When choosing a daycare in Tonawanda, consider visiting facilities in person, checking their licensing status, and asking about staff-to-child ratios, daily routines, and safety policies.
